1. whitlow grass
noun.
Annual
weed
of
Europe
and
North
America
having
a
rosette
of
basal
leaves
and
tiny
flowers
followed
by
oblong
seed
capsules.
Synonyms
shad-flower
shadflower
Draba verna
draba

2. whitlow
noun.
(ˈwɪtˌloʊ, ˈhwɪtˌloʊ)
A
purulent
infection
at
the
end
of
a
finger
or
toe
in
the
area
surrounding
the
nail.
Synonyms
infection
felon
